Let the words of my mouth, and the meditation of my heart, be acceptable in thy sight, O LORD, my strength, and my redeemer.

Bible References

Let

Psalm 5:1
Give ear to my words, LORD. Consider my meditation.
Psalm 51:15
Lord, open my lips. My mouth shall declare your praise.
Psalm 66:18
If I cherished sin in my heart, the Lord wouldn't have listened.
Psalm 119:108
Accept, I beg you, the willing offerings of my mouth. LORD, teach me your ordinances.
Genesis 4:4
Abel also brought some of the firstborn of his flock and of its fat. The LORD respected Abel and his offering,
Proverbs 15:8
The sacrifice made by the wicked is an abomination to the LORD, but the prayer of the upright is his delight.
Romans 15:16
that I should be a servant of Christ Jesus to the Gentiles, serving as a priest the Good News of God, that the offering up of the Gentiles might be made acceptable, sanctified by the Holy Spirit.
Hebrews 11:4
By faith, Abel offered to God a more excellent sacrifice than Cain, through which he had testimony given to him that he was righteous, God testifying with respect to his gifts; and through it he, being dead, still speaks.
Hebrews 13:15
Through him, then, let us offer up a sacrifice of praise to God continually, that is, the fruit of lips that confess his name.
1 Peter 2:5
You also, as living stones, are built up as a spiritual house, to be a holy priesthood, to offer up spiritual sacrifices, acceptable to God through Jesus Christ.

Redeemer

Job 19:25
But as for me, I know that my Redeemer lives. In the end, he will stand upon the earth.
Isaiah 43:14
Thus says the LORD, your Redeemer, the Holy One of Israel: "For your sake, I have sent to Babylon, and I will bring all of them down as fugitives, even the Chaldeans, in the ships of their rejoicing.
Isaiah 44:6
This is what the LORD, the King of Israel, and his Redeemer, the LORD of hosts, says: "I am the first, and I am the last; and besides me there is no God.
Isaiah 47:4
Our Redeemer, the LORD of hosts is his name, the Holy One of Israel.
Isaiah 54:5
For your husband is your Creator; the LORD of hosts is his name: and the Holy One of Israel is your Redeemer; the God of the whole earth shall he be called.
1 Thessalonians 1:10
and to wait for his Son from heaven, whom he raised from the dead?Jesus, who delivers us from the wrath to come.
Titus 2:14
who gave himself for us, that he might redeem us from all iniquity, and purify for himself a people for his own possession, zealous for good works.
1 Peter 1:18
knowing that you were redeemed, not with corruptible things, with silver or gold, from the useless way of life handed down from your fathers,
Revelation 5:9
They sang a new song, saying, "You are worthy to take the scroll, and to open its seals: for you were killed, and redeemed us for God with your blood, out of every tribe, language, people, and nation,
